We now have an exciting opportunity for an Associate Partner to join our Planning Division in Manchester. This is a truly exciting time to join the business as we undertake our new growth and development plans. This role is offered on a hybrid basis, with a mixture of office and home working.
Job Purpose
Engaged in the ongoing delivery and management of projects as agreed by the Partner in accordance with the project plan. Acting as planning practitioner as well as supporting the Partner in their role within the team and as required within the department.
Key responsibilities include:
- Conducting and managing planning activities
- Day to day management of projects including where applicable: project planning, reviews, WiP/invoicing and debts
- The management of projects with a view to meeting agreed client requirements and deadlines in accord with the QA system
- Client management in support of Partner
- Ability to represent clients at public meetings
- Strong professional report writing skills
- Maintaining a thorough technical knowledge in the field of town planning and technical expertise
- Maintaining professional membership of the Royal Town Planning Institute
- Responsible for contributing to own continuing professional development through attendance at appropriate training courses and internal CPD sessions and wider reading.
Senior positions will also require:
- Quality control of output of projects in accordance with the approved QA system including preparing project plans and fee agreements
- Contribution to the development and management of the wider business including work winning and marketing
- Management of immediate staff including timesheets, holidays, CPD and training
- Supervision of junior members of staff
Scope of role (staff, clients, products, equipment)
- Control of projects
- Maintaining client contacts in respect of project working
- Ensuring that the quality of advice and work meets the required standard.
Personal Attributes
- Chartered RTPI.
- Ability to build and manage new and existing client relationships.
- Proven track record of an exceptional level of competence and breadth of expertise.
- Business development skills – ability to secure significant new business for the firm as a whole.
- Management of the day-to-day workload of a Rapleys team and effectively control profitability.
- Responsibility for the direction and performance of a substantial specified area of the business.
- Maintain and support Rapleys Core Values and Culture.
